Charlotte Elizabeth Browne, daughter of Michael Browne, was born in 1790 in Norwich, Enlgand. She married George Phelan (d, 1837) in 1813 and spent two years with him while he served with his regiment in Nova Scotia (1817-1819).They then returned to Ireland. They separated in about 1824. She married Lewis Hippolytus Joseph Tonna in 1841. She died in Ramsgate, Kent, England in 1846.

In this fascinating memoir, Charlotte Elizabeth Tonna recounts her experiences growing up in Colonial-era Britain and her subsequent career as a writer and social activist. Born in 1790, Tonna was a prolific author, writing on a wide range of topics, including women's rights, religious reform, and social justice. Her memoirs offer a valuable glimpse into the life of a remarkable woman who played an important role in shaping the intellectual and cultural landscape of her time.
